1973 Mini Clubman vs. 1983 Toyota Blizzard

To start off, 1983 Toyota Blizzard is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Mini Clubman.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Mini Clubman would be higher. At 2,188 cc (4 cylinders), 1983 Toyota Blizzard is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1983 Toyota Blizzard (67 HP @ 4200 RPM) has 29 more horse power than 1973 Mini Clubman. (38 HP @ 5250 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1983 Toyota Blizzard should accelerate faster than 1973 Mini Clubman.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1983 Toyota Blizzard weights approximately 580 kg more than 1973 Mini Clubman.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1983 Toyota Blizzard is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1973 Mini Clubman.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1983 Toyota Blizzard will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1983 Toyota Blizzard (142 Nm @ 2400 RPM) has 70 more torque (in Nm) than 1973 Mini Clubman. (72 Nm @ 2700 RPM). This means 1983 Toyota Blizzard will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1973 Mini Clubman.

Compare all specifications:

1973 Mini Clubman 1983 Toyota Blizzard
Make Mini Toyota
Model Clubman Blizzard
Year Released 1973 1983
Body Type Hatchback S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 998 cc 2188 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 38 HP 67 HP
Engine RPM 5250 RPM 4200 RPM
Torque 72 Nm 142 Nm
Torque RPM 2700 RPM 2400 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Front 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Weight 680 kg 1260 kg
Vehicle Length 3180 mm 3530 mm
Vehicle Width 1420 mm 1470 mm
Vehicle Height 1360 mm 1880 mm
Wheelbase Size 2040 mm 2030 mm
